How they compare
Eastern Asia currently reports 86,795 kmsq against 12,278 kmsq in Indonesia, a difference of 74,517 kmsq.
That makes Eastern Asia's figure about 7.1 times Indonesia's.
Across all 23 years both countries report, Eastern Asia has been ahead every year.
Eastern Asia ranks 17th and Indonesia ranks 18th of 39 groups.
Eastern Asia has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Eastern Asia | Indonesia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 59,960 kmsq | 6,828 kmsq | 53,132 kmsq | Eastern Asia |
| 2010s | 66,630 kmsq | 9,179 kmsq | 57,451 kmsq | Eastern Asia |
| 2020s | 83,732 kmsq | 12,243 kmsq | 71,490 kmsq | Eastern Asia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
